AWS Amplify introduces data seeding
Share
Services
AWS Amplify now supports seeding data across Amazon Cognito, AWS AppSync, Amazon DynamoDB, and Amazon S3\. Developers can programmatically create test users and associated resources through new APIs and a CLI command.
This feature simplifies testing and development workflows by enabling quick population of auth-dependent resources. Create Cognito users, seed DynamoDB records via AppSync with user context, and upload S3 objects - all while maintaining proper authentication relationships. This eliminates manual user creation and authentication steps previously required for testing auth-protected resources.
This feature is available in all regions where AWS Amplify is supported.
